Strong Earthquake Shakes Almaty: Residents Experience Tremors

In the early hours of January 23, 2024, Almaty, the largest city in Kazakhstan, experienced a powerful earthquake, leaving residents startled and shaken.

The seismic event, which occurred at approximately 00:05 local time, was confirmed by the Network of Seismic Stations under the Ministry of Emergencies of the Republic of Kazakhstan.

The earthquake was officially registered at 00:09:02 Almaty time. The epicenter of the seismic activity was identified to be 264 kilometers southeast of Almaty, situated on the border between Kazakhstan and Kyrgyzstan, as disclosed by the press service of the Emergency Situations Department.

Providing further details, the Emergency Situations Department stated that the earthquake’s energy class was measured at 15.1, with a magnitude of MPV 6.7. The coordinates of the epicenter were reported as northwest – 41.22°, 1.78°W, and the seismic event occurred at a depth of 65 kilometers.

Residents in Almaty reported feeling the impact, with the earthquake registering 4 points on the MSK-64 scale in the city. The Ministry of Emergencies is closely monitoring the situation, and no immediate reports of major damage or casualties have been received.
